c++算法|在线学习_爱学大百科共计3篇文章

看看你在看什么网站,哦!亲爱的宝贝。爱学大百科这么宝藏的网站都让你找到了,那我们就来了解了解关于c++算法的信息吧。
1.C++回溯算法基础入门c++回溯【C++】回溯算法基础入门 简介 回溯算法基于深度优先搜索,实际上一个类似枚举的搜索尝试过程,主要是在搜索尝试过程中寻找问题的解,当发现已不满足求解条件时,就“回溯”返回,尝试别的路径。 由于非递归式回溯算法较难实现,本文只介绍递归式回溯。 回溯算法框架https://blog.csdn.net/u011956367/article/details/120555480
2.C++入门基础——双壁传奇C语言和C++的爱恨情仇C 语言主要遵循面向过程编程范式,程序的设计围绕着函数和数据结构展开,强调算法的实现和数据的处理流程。例如,一个简单的 C 语言程序可能是一系列函数的顺序调用,通过函数之间的数据传递来完成特定任务。而 C++ 支持多种编程范式,除了面向对象编程外,还可以进行面向过程编程(兼容 C 语言风格)以及泛型编程。泛型编程通过https://cloud.tencent.com/developer/article/2479565
3.C++常见算法大全(自用)51CTO博客C++常见算法大全(自用) 文章目录 查找算法 排序和通用算法 删除和替换算法 排列组合算法 生成和异变算法 关系算法 集合算法 堆算法https://blog.51cto.com/u_15744744/6128209
4.C++算法(豆瓣)《国外经典教材?C++算法:图算法(第3版)》所关注的是图算法领域。从实用的视角,以独特的结构将有关内容组织在一起,从而使读者不仅可以对这一领域有系统性的认识,而且还可在实践中灵活使用所提供的算法工具。本版中,增加了数以千计的新练习、数百年新图表以及数十个新程序,而且对所有的图表和程序都做了详尽的https://book.douban.com/subject/1138527/
5.C++经典算法集锦一咋一看,我曹感觉复杂,没有关系我们先把第一个操作完成,后面就是递归调用这个操作,你懂的。好吧,接下来让我们徒手写快排吧,如果你能够随时随地写一个快排,那么你对算法应该也已经从入门到精通了。 voidquick_sort(inta[],intleft,intright){if(left>=right){return;}inti=left;intj=right;intkey=a[i];whilehttps://www.jianshu.com/p/35d34fa7eb43
6.C++回溯算法C++回溯算法 「回溯算法 backtracking algorithm」是一种通过穷举来解决问题的方法,它的核心思想是从一个初始状态出发,暴力搜索所有可能的解决方案,当遇到正确的解则将其记录,直到找到解或者尝试了所有可能的选择都无法找到解为止。 回溯算法通常采用“深度优先搜索”来遍历解空间。在二叉树章节中,我们提到前序、中序和https://www.w3cschool.cn/hellocpp/hellocpp-ct6o3tl4.html
7.算法(现代C++)MicrosoftLearnC/C++语言 C运行库参考 标准C++库参考 SafeInt库 使用英语阅读 保存 添加到集合 添加到计划 通过 Facebookx.com 共享LinkedIn电子邮件 打印 项目 2013/03/25 本文内容 循环 请参见 现代的 C++ 编程中,我们建议您使用的算法在标准模板库(STL)。下面是一些重要的示例: https://docs.microsoft.com/zh-cn/previous-versions/visualstudio/visual-studio-2012/hh438471(v=vs.110)
8.C++与STL(紫皮算法书·例题)#include<bits/stdc++.h>#include<string>usingnamespacestd;//这道题的思路突出点在于提取了四种操作中的共同点,即:找到位置、上方归位、叠放//这道题我尝试把例题中的vector用string代替,因为叠放过程用字符串尾接感觉会很自然//虽然看起来并没有变好什么。。。intn;constintmaxn=30;stringpiles[maxn];https://zhuanlan.zhihu.com/p/13683331683
9.C++STL常用算法STL变异算法是一组能修改容器元素数据的模板函数。可以对序列数据进行复制,交换,替换,填充,删除,旋转,分割等操作。应用变异算法时,应先检查容器的迭代器是否符合要求,防止产生编译错误。 1.OutputIterator copy<InputIterator first,InputIterator last,OutputIterator result > 正向拷贝 (result 的长度不能小于last-firsthttp://www.360doc.com/content/11/0722/14/3972135_135192525.shtml
10.《C++数据结构与算法(高清)》.pdf文档全文免费阅读在线看C++ USING BY C++ 第一部分 预备知识 第1章 C + +程序设计 大家好!现在我们将要开始一个穿越“数据结构、算法和程序”这个抽象世界的特殊旅程, 以解决现实生活中的许多难题。在程序开发过程中通常需要做到如下两点:一是高效地描述数 据;二是设计一个好的算法,该算法最终可用程序来实现。要想高效地描述数据,必须https://max.book118.com/html/2015/1229/32232263.shtm
11.C++中的数据结构及其相关算法C++c++是一种广泛使用的编程语言,它支持多种数据结构和算法。数据结构是存储和组织数据的方法,而算法是在数据结构上操作数据的方法。对于每个问题,选择合适的数据结构和算法是非常重要的。在本文中,我们将介绍一些常用的数据结构和算法,以及它们在c++中的实现。 https://www.php.cn/faq/594412.html
12.清华大学出版社图书详情这本《C++数据结构与算法(第4版)》全面系统地介绍了数据结构,并以C++语言实现相关的算法。 主要强调了数据结构和算法之间的联系,使用面向对象的方法介绍数据结构,其内容包括算法的复杂度分析、链表、栈、队列、递归、二叉树、图、排序和散列。本书还清晰地阐述了同类教材中较少提到的内存管理、数据压缩和字符串匹配http://www.tup.tsinghua.edu.cn/booksCenter/book_05725003.html
13.C/C++高精度算法实现思路与代码C语言C/C++高精度算法实现思路与代码更新时间:2023年11月28日 15:08:37 作者:仍有未知等待探索 高精度算法就是能处理高精度数各种运算的算法,但又因其特殊性,故从普通数的算法中分离,自成一家,下面这篇文章主要给大家介绍了关于C/C++高精度算法实现思路与代码的相关资料,需要的朋友可以参考下https://www.jb51.net/program/306243h0n.htm
14.最高年薪30W,本周武汉这处还有2场招聘会5、负责3D点云相关算法研究,保证项目的可行; 6、参与机器视觉(3D)项目技术调研、方案制定; 7、负责图像处理、视觉定位、视觉测量等领域的算法研究与实现。 任职要求: 1、硕士以上学历,博士优先; 2、精通C/C++或Python编程、计算机视觉、3D点云处理算法(点云配准、拼接、特征提取等)、三维重建、模型匹配、计算机图https://www.wuhan.gov.cn/sy/whyw/202305/t20230508_2197263.shtml